What Are Biostimulators?



Biostimulators are innovative restorative representatives used in dermatology to improve the skin's regenerative procedures. These substances, which can include a selection of naturally acquired compounds, are created to stimulate collagen and elastin production, eventually advertising skin elasticity and firmness. Typically used biostimulators consist of polylactic acid (PLA) and calcium hydroxylapatite, each of which has special homes adding to skin restoration.


The system of activity of biostimulators rotates around their capability to turn on fibroblasts, the cells liable for producing vital extracellular matrix parts. By launching a waterfall of organic responses, biostimulators not only enhance the architectural integrity of the skin but likewise promote healing and repair service. This characteristic makes them particularly useful in treating numerous skin-related conditions, consisting of wrinkles, sagging skin, and marks.


Biostimulators are normally provided with minimally invasive procedures, offering a much less intrusive option to standard surgical interventions. Their progressive effects, which establish gradually as collagen synthesis rises, provide a natural-looking enhancement. As the area of dermatology remains to progress, biostimulators represent an encouraging opportunity for attaining youthful and rejuvenated skin through advanced therapeutic strategies.

Device of Activity



Promoting the body's natural processes, biostimulators work primarily through mechanisms that motivate collagen production and cells regrowth. These representatives, commonly stemmed from natural sources, exert their impacts by connecting with numerous cellular paths. Upon administration, biostimulators initiate a cascade of biological reactions that trigger fibroblasts-- cells in charge of collagen synthesis. This activation brings about boosted extracellular matrix formation, enhancing skin flexibility and quantity.


Furthermore, biostimulators can modulate inflammatory responses, creating an ideal environment for recovery. By promoting angiogenesis, they enhance blood flow to the cured area, making sure that nutrients and oxygen are efficiently supplied to support mobile activities. The steady release of development aspects from biostimulators also plays an important role, as these factors signal nearby cells to proliferate and migrate, helping with tissue fixing.


In enhancement to promoting collagen, biostimulators might affect elastin manufacturing and glycosaminoglycan synthesis, contributing to improved skin texture and hydration. The collaborating impacts of these systems lead to an obvious rejuvenation of the skin gradually, developing biostimulators as an important device in modern dermatological therapies.
